Warning about benicassim2010.com website

We have had several messages from concerned festival goers who have purchased tickets from benicassim2010.com.  This site appears as a paid for listing when you search Google.

Please be warned that benicassim2010.com is not an official Benicassim ticketing partner.  We strongly recommend that you do not purchase tickets from this site.

If you are looking for tickets for Benicassim then please make sure that you buy them from an official ticketing partner, as found on our ticket information page.

*** UPDATE 24th June 2010 ***

Many of our readers who have purchased tickets from Benicassim2010.com have received an email informing them that they cannot fulfill their ticket order.  If you have ordered tickets from Benicassim2010.com we strongly recommend that you contact your bank or credit card issuer and inform them of the situation.  Most credit card companies should be able to issue a charge back and recover your money.  Please be aware that tickets for this year’s festival are still available to buy through authorised ticketing agents, visit our tickets page for details.  We hope that you can make it to this years festival!

    The things that makes it unlikely that it’s a real touting site is that

    1. Much of the information on the site is outdated – Much of the lineup still hasn’t been updated.

    2. The site offers no security checks, e.c.t. All legit firms offer these checks in order to prevent themselves being seen fraudulent.

    3. It’s not an official partner to the Benicassim festival, which also means they are not given tickets to sell for a profit. This means that if this site WAS real, they would have to be purchasing thousands of tickets off a site like seetickets for example, and then sell them at a more expensive price to enable themselves to earn revenue as well. However, that doesn’t look like it’s the case – which gives reason to believe that it’s fake, because there seems to be no incentive for them.

    4. Although the other sites also dispatch tickets just 2 weeks before the event, they also offer the option for the benicassim festival to print the tickets out yourself at home instead of waiting. However for this site, you can’t do that, which further adds to the mystique of the site.

    5. The owners have made no attempt to prevent fraudulent accusations.
